episode_narrativeAn upper level wave moving through N CA/NV provided plentiful forcing for storms to develop on July 30. In fact, showers lingered overnight the night before across portions of the Sierra and NE CA. These storms produced robust outflows with multiple areas of blowing dust and one true haboob/dust storm. We also had flooding that closed a roadway that afternoon/evening along US-395 near the Red Rock area.
event_narrativeBlowing dust was observed, resulting from thunderstorm outflows, from both the NDOT Camera along US-95 at Luning and the Pilot Peak Alert Camera which points to US-95 just south of Mina. Reports from a spotter in Hawthorne confirmed the dust, but also mentioned visibility around 1-3 miles in that area, not meeting Dust Storm Warning Criteria.
